February 2026 milestone: Completed a distributed tracing overhaul in the newrelic-python-agent, introducing a hybrid core tracing implementation, adaptive sampling, and OpenTelemetry integration. The release enhances end-to-end visibility, reduces sampling overhead, and aligns with modern telemetry standards. Key refactors include reordering span node inheritance for correct attribute propagation, eliminating *args/**kwargs from core tracing paths, and introducing a new adaptive sampling target configuration. The work also delivers broader instrumentation coverage, regression tests, and CI hygiene to support stable production release across services.
